Charles L. Osborne died on December 4, 1983, in Patchegue, N.Y. at the age of 66. A native of Toston, Montana, he graduated from Beaverhead High School in Dillon, Montana.
Attended the University of California.
Helene Stark was a laboratory technician in the Health Division at the Metallurgical Laboratory in Chicago during the Manhattan Project.
Roland Davis was a laboratory assistant at the University of Chicago’s Metallurgical Laboratory (“Met Lab) during the Manhattan Project.
